MOBILE VENDING PLN2404-0050
LDCT-24-04 / ORDINANCE 25-12 fka 24-65 COUNTY-INITIATED LAND DEVELOPMENT CODE TEXT AMENDMENT CHAPTER 10 GENERAL CLEAN-UP - PLN2404-0123
The Board of County Commissioners of Manatee County, Florida proposes to adopt the following ordinance:
An Ordinance of the Board of County Commissioners of Manatee County, Florida, amending the Manatee County Land Development Code; providing for purpose and intent; providing findings; amending Land Development Code Chapter 2 – Definitions, Chapter 4 - Zoning, Chapter 5 – Standards for Accessory and Specific Uses and Structures, and Chapter 10 – Transportation Management to define the use of Mobile Vending, to add Mobile Vending units as an accessory and temporary use, to add Mobile Vending Parks as a use in specified zoning districts, to set forth specific use criteria for Mobile Vending units, Mobile Vending Parks and applicable parking standards; providing for other amendments as may be necessary for internal consistency; providing for codification; providing for applicability; providing for severability; and providing an effective date.

An Ordinance of the Board of County Commissioners of Manatee County, Florida, regarding land development, amending the Official Zoning Atlas (Ordinance 15-17, as amended, the Manatee County Land Development Code), relating to zoning within the unincorporated area; providing for a rezone of approximately 5.25± acres from A (General Agriculture) to PDC (Planned Development Commercial) Zoning District; approving a Preliminary Site Plan for up to 114,345 square feet of mini-warehouse use with additional outdoor storage which will not count towards the FAR; generally located approximately 1,900 feet west of the intersection of State Road 64 East and Uihlein Road and also on the north side of SR 64 East, Bradenton (Manatee County); subject to stipulations as conditions of approval, setting forth findings; providing a legal description; providing for severability; and providing an effective date.
An Ordinance of the Board of County Commissioners of Manatee County, Florida, regarding land development; amending and restating Zoning Ordinance No. PDR-23-17(P) for an 183 unit multi-family project, with at least 25 percent of the units designated as affordable housing to include a previously approved development option (Option A – four 3-story buildings) and add an additional development option (Option B – one 4-story building) on approximately 9.16 acres; the project site is zoned PDR (Planned Development Residential) and generally located between Bayshore Rd, 89th St E, and US 41 N and commonly known as 2220 89th St E, Palmetto (Manatee County); subject to stipulations as conditions of approval; setting forth findings; providing a legal description; providing for severability; and providing an effective date.
An Ordinance of the Board of County Commissioners of Manatee County, Florida, regarding land development, to reestablish an abandoned use by approving a General Development Plan which will allow a Large Residential Treatment Facility or a Large Assisted Living Facility of 90 beds for an existing 36,449 square feet structure currently zoned PDR (Planned Development Residential);the property is located 0.51 miles south of 53rd Avenue East and 863 feet west of US 301 on 6.60 ± acres, and commonly known as 5700 24th Steet East, Bradenton (Manatee County); subject to stipulations as conditions of approval; setting forth findings; providing a legal description; providing for severability; and providing an effective date.
An Ordinance of the Board of County Commissioners of Manatee County, Florida, regarding land development, amending the Official Zoning Atlas (Ordinance 15-17, as amended, the Manatee County Land Development Code) relating to zoning within the unincorporated area, providing for a rezone of approximately 3.3 acres located on the southern portion of a ±23.4-acre site (where ±20.1 acres are currently zoned PDR (Planned Development Residential)) from A-1/WP-E/ST ((Agricultural Suburban/ Evers Reservoir Watershed Protection / Special Treatment Overlay Districts) to PDR Zoning District retaining the overlay districts, generally located on the east side of Lockwood Ridge Road, approximately 600 feet south of the intersection with Whitfield Avenue, and commonly known as 7225 Lockwood Ridge Road, Sarasota (Manatee County); approving a General Development Plan for the total ±23.4 acre site allowing up to 256 multifamily units with at least twenty five percent (25%) of those units designated as affordable housing; subject to a proposed Land Use Restriction Agreement (LURA); subject to stipulations as conditions of approval; setting forth findings; providing a legal description; providing for severability; and providing an effective date.
An Ordinance of the Board of County Commissioners of Manatee County, Florida, regarding land development, amending the Official Zoning Atlas (Ordinance 15-17, as amended, the Manatee County Land Development Code), relating to zoning within the unincorporated area; providing for a rezone of approximately 126.33± acres generally located north of SR 70, east of Post Blvd, southeast of Rangeland Pkwy and west of Uihlein Road, and commonly known as 5895 Post Boulevard, Bradenton (Manatee County) from A/WP-E/ST (General Agriculture/Watershed Protection Evers/Special Treatment Overlay Districts) to the PDPI (Planned Development Public Interest) Zoning District, retaining the WP-E/ST (Watershed Protection Evers/Special Treatment) Overlay Districts; amending a General Development Plan for a County park to add 126.33± acres to the project area for a total of 236.31± acres and add such uses that include but are not limited to County office space, public use facilities (i.e. public library, sheriff substation, EMS station), aquatic center, dog park, softball and baseball complex and fields, concessions, park maintenance facilities, racquetball complex, tennis stadium and courts (clay and/or hard courts), pickleball stadium and courts, locker room facilities, restrooms, multiuse building, hotel, secondary storage barn, multipurpose fields (existing), parking (existing) and stadium (existing), and other associated facilities, gymnasium and accessory passive recreation (i.e. permanent frame tent, maintenance area), trails, outdoor fitness equipment, fitness/play landforms, plazas, destination playgrounds, shade pavilions; subject to stipulations as conditions of approval; setting forth findings; providing a legal description; providing for severability; and providing an effective date.
An Ordinance of the Board of County Commissioners of Manatee County, Florida, regarding land development, amending the Official Zoning Atlas (Ordinance 15-17, as amended, the Manatee County Land Development Code), relating to zoning within the unincorporated area; providing for a rezone of an approximately 44.68-acre part of a 658.98-acre parcel generally located 4,000 feet west of the intersection of County Road 39 and Carlton Road, Parrish (Manatee County) from the EX (Extraction) to the A (General Agriculture) Zoning District; setting forth findings; providing a legal description; providing for severability, and providing an effective date.
